CASE v. CHESAPEAKE & OHIO R. CO.

No. 81-5880.

712 F.2d 1089 (1983)

James Martin CASE,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. CHESAPEAKE AND OHIO RAILWAY COMPANY, Defendant-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, Sixth Circuit.

Decided August 1, 1983.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Arnold Turner, Jr. (argued), Prestonsburg, Ky., for plaintiff-appellant.

James E. Cleveland, III (argued), Paul C. Hobbs, Ashland, Ky., Donald Combs, Stephens, Combs & Page, Pikeville, Ky., for defendant-appellee.

Before EDWARDS, Chief Circuit Judge, ENGEL, Circuit Judge, and PHILLIPS, Senior Circuit Judge.


GEORGE CLIFTON EDWARDS, Jr., Chief Circuit Judge.

This case was decided as a matter of law by the District Court on the Chesapeake and Ohio Railway Company motion for summary judgment. Case's appeal contends that, under applicable Kentucky law and the particular facts set forth in his complaint, he was entitled to a jury trial. We agree and reverse for trial.
